Ziho's Performance Revolution

The AE8 isn't just another electric scooter—it's a direct 250cc competitor with serious engineering. After analyzing its liquid-cooled mid-motor producing 12.5kW peak power and 160 lb-ft torque, I believe its 0-30mph in 2.6 seconds makes it a highway-capable game-changer. The dual 69V/33Ah batteries deliver 75 miles range, but the real standout is the 2-hour fast charging—unheard of in this class.

What often goes unmentioned? The premium components: Brembo calipers, Bosch ABS, and rebound-damping suspension transform urban commuting. According to industry benchmarks, this combination typically reduces brake fade by 40% versus entry-level systems.

Horwin's Practical Play: S3 & The Upcoming Cenmenti

The S3's brilliance lies in its modularity. Swapping batteries in seconds solves the "charging downtime" problem—crucial for delivery riders. However, its 6-8 hour charge time reveals a trade-off. The real headline? Horwin's 2023 Cenmenti Zero promises motorcycle-tier specs: 125mph top speed, 186-mile range, and 400V charging that hits 80% in 30 minutes. Critical Tech & Buying Considerations

Battery strategy defines usability. Honda’s EM1e bets on swappable packs using their Mobile Power Pack system—ideal for city dwellers without home charging. Contrast this with Ziho’s fixed ultra-fast charging or Yadea’s regen braking that recaptures 15% energy in stop-and-go traffic.

Aftermarket integration is another key factor. V-Modo’s F01 focuses on fleet telematics, while Ziho’s app-controlled features (cruise control, GPS anti-theft) cater to tech-savvy commuters. If you prioritize low ownership costs, V-Modo’s maintenance-optimized design warrants serious attention.

The Hidden Cost Factor

Resale value remains electric scooters' Achilles heel. Models with proprietary charging (like Ziho) may depreciate faster if networks don’t expand as promised. Conversely, Honda’s standardized swappable batteries could retain 30% more value—a crucial consideration overlooked in initial purchases.
